Output 570ba51ea2f65b996363ae620c95c09bd938176800aab2e927b0ffcbe6ac9df4:1

value
553268
script pubkey
OP_0 OP_PUSHBYTES_20 88f3f3edd766008d4c16826d6cf71aacfbeb86bf
address
tb1q3rel8mwhvcqg6nqksfkkeac64na7hp4lhjdruc
transaction
570ba51ea2f65b996363ae620c95c09bd938176800aab2e927b0ffcbe6ac9df4
confirmations
114674
spent
false